AI-Powered Threat Detection
One of the key roles of AI in cybersecurity is threat detection. AI algorithms are capable of analyzing vast amounts of data in real-time to identify patterns and anomalies that may indicate a potential security threat. By continuously monitoring network traffic, user behavior, and system logs, AI-powered security systems can quickly detect and respond to suspicious activities before they escalate into full-blown attacks.
Machine learning algorithms play a crucial role in this process by learning from past incidents and continuously improving their ability to recognize new and emerging threats. This adaptive approach to threat detection allows organizations to stay ahead of evolving cyber threats and better protect their digital assets.
Behavioral Analysis and Anomaly Detection
AI technologies excel at behavioral analysis and anomaly detection, which are essential for identifying insider threats and zero-day attacks. By establishing baselines of normal user behavior, AI systems can flag deviations that may indicate a potential security risk. For example, if an employee suddenly starts accessing sensitive files outside of their normal working hours, an AI-powered security system can raise an alert and prompt further investigation.
Moreover, AI can detect subtle signs of compromise that may go unnoticed by traditional security tools. By analyzing user activity, network traffic, and system logs in real-time, AI algorithms can identify unusual patterns that could be indicative of a security breach. This proactive approach to cybersecurity enables organizations to respond swiftly to emerging threats and mitigate potential damage before it escalates.
Automated Incident Response
In addition to threat detection, AI plays a vital role in automating incident response processes. When a security incident is detected, AI-powered systems can take immediate action to contain the threat, isolate affected systems, and prevent further damage. By leveraging AI for incident response, organizations can significantly reduce response times, minimize the impact of security incidents, and enhance overall resilience against cyber threats.
Furthermore, AI can assist cybersecurity teams in prioritizing alerts and incidents based on their severity and potential impact on the organization. By streamlining incident response workflows and providing actionable insights, AI technologies enable security teams to focus their efforts on addressing the most critical threats first.
